The toddler refuses to take his oral medication. What is the best suggestion to the mother from the nurse for ensuring the toddler receives his medication?
1. "Tell him you will buy him a toy if he takes the medication."
2. "Crush the tablet and mix it with a small amount of jam."
3. "Crush the tablet and mix it with milk."
4. "Tell him he will be punished if he does not take the medicine."
Correct Answer: 2
Rationale: Mixing the medication in jam will disguise the taste. The parent should not buy the child's compliance with a toy. Punishment will alienate the child and decrease compliance. Parents should avoid placing medication in milk as this may cause the toddler to avoid healthy foods.
